The Earthwise 14 Chainsaw is a 14-inch electric chainsaw designed for light to medium-duty cutting tasks around the home. It features a powerful motor, automatic oiling system, tool-free chain tensioning, low-kickback safety bar and chain, and a lightweight design for easy handling. Main components located on saw body.
Front: Guide bar, chain, hand guard, chain brake (if equipped). Top: Oil fill cap, tensioning knob. Rear: Motor housing, rear handle with trigger, safety lockout button, cord strain relief.
Operation Controls: Press safety lockout button with thumb, then squeeze trigger to start chain. Release trigger to stop chain. Chain brake activates if hand guard is pushed forward during kickback.

| Symptom | Possible Cause | Corrective Action |
|---|---|---|
| Saw will not start | No power, safety lockout not engaged | Check outlet and cord; ensure lockout button is pressed while pulling trigger. |
| Chain does not move | Chain brake engaged, loose drive sprocket | Pull back hand guard to disengage brake; check sprocket and clutch. |
| Chain oil not flowing | Empty reservoir, clogged oil port | Fill oil tank; clean oil holes in bar; check oil pump function. |
| Chain comes off bar | Loose chain tension, worn bar or sprocket | Retension chain; inspect bar rails and sprocket for wear; replace if needed. |
| Poor cutting performance | Dull chain, improper filing, low oil | Sharpen chain; check filing angle; ensure adequate oil supply. |
| Overheating or smoking | Dull chain, insufficient oil, forcing cut | Sharpen chain; fill oil; use lighter cutting pressure; allow motor to cool. |
